About MacBrightness
MacBrightness is a utility application designed specifically for modern MacBook Pro models and the Pro Display XDR to unlock their full brightness potential. While macOS typically caps screen brightness at around 50 percent of what the display hardware can actually achieve, MacBrightness gives users access to the complete brightness range, allowing the screen to reach up to 1,600 nits. This means your Mac can go nearly twice as bright as the operating system normally permits. The application works system-wide, meaning every application benefits from the increased brightness, not just HDR video content. It integrates seamlessly with the existing brightness keys on your keyboard, so there are no new shortcuts to learn or menu bars to navigate. MacBrightness is designed for professionals, travelers, remote workers, and anyone who uses their Mac in bright environments like sunny patios, airport gates, or next to large windows. The software operates with no noticeable CPU overhead and uses no low-level system hacks, making it safe and efficient. It opens in a free Splitscreen Mode that lights up half the screen to full brightness for comparison, and users can unlock the full screen with a one-time purchase, with no subscription required. The application requires macOS 13 or later and works with MacBook Pro 14-inch and 16-inch models featuring M-series Pro or Max chips, as well as the Pro Display XDR.

No Performance Overhead or System Hacks
MacBrightness operates with no noticeable CPU overhead and uses no low-level system hacks or kernel extensions. It simply opens the HDR brightness range that your display already supports and keeps in reserve for HDR content. This means your Mac runs normally, battery life is not significantly impacted, and there is no risk of system instability. The application is lightweight, efficient, and designed to work transparently in the background, only affecting brightness when you choose to increase it beyond the standard limit.

Which Mac models are compatible with MacBrightness?
MacBrightness is compatible with MacBook Pro 14-inch and 16-inch models that feature M-series Pro or Max chips, as well as the Pro Display XDR. These models use mini-LED panels that can sustain around 1,600 nits of brightness. Other Mac models may not have the hardware capability to support the full brightness range that MacBrightness unlocks. You can check your Mac's specifications in the About This Mac section to confirm compatibility. The application requires macOS 13 or later to run.
Does MacBrightness affect battery life or system performance?
MacBrightness is designed to have no noticeable CPU overhead and uses no low-level system hacks. It simply opens the HDR brightness range that your display already supports, so there is minimal impact on battery life. Running the display at higher brightness will consume more power, as it would with any brightness increase, but the application itself uses negligible processing resources. You can expect normal system performance and battery behavior while using MacBrightness.
